BECS RabbitMQ Connector


About RabbitMQ

RabbitMQ is lightweight and easy to deploy on premises and in the cloud. It supports multiple messaging protocols. RabbitMQ can be deployed in distributed and federated configurations to meet high-scale, high-availability requirements.

RabbitMQ runs on many operating systems and cloud environments, and provides a wide range of developer tools for most popular languages.

RabbitMQ is an open-source message-broker software that originally implemented the Advanced Message Queuing Protocol (AMQP) and has since been extended with a plug-in architecture to support Streaming Text Oriented Messaging Protocol (STOMP), Message Queuing Telemetry Transport (MQTT), and other protocols.

BECS RabbitMQ Connector enables very easy and quick integration between RabbitMQ and 3rd party systems. BECS RabbitMQ Connector has implemented following set of functions:

Declare Exchange, Declare Queue, Bind Queue, Send Message.

 

BECS RabbitMQ Connector documentation

 

How to install BECS RabbitMQ Connector

BECS RabbitMQ Connector prerequisites

BECS RabbitMQ connector requires:

BECS RabbitMQ Connector Installation Procedure

Whole process will drive following steps:

  1. Installation of standard BECS package
  2. After installation (if standard package does not include RabbitMQ Connector), is necessary copy dll file “Ace.Integrator.RabbitMQ.dll”, “RabbitMQ.Client.dll” and “RabbitMQ.Client.xml” to BECS installation path.
  3. After installation (if standard package does not include RabbitMQ Connector), is necessary copy dll file “Ace.Integrator.RabbitMQ.dll”, “RabbitMQ.Client.dll” and “RabbitMQ.Client.xml”  to   BECS Visual Architect installation path (Architect\Extensions\Application).
  4. Product will be after Activation ready to use.

 

BECS_5F00_RabbitMQ_5F00_Connector_5F00_DLLs.zip